holder - a person who holds something; "they held two hostages"; "he holds the trophy"; "she holds a United States passport"
  possessor, owner (law) someone who owns (is legal possessor of) a business; "he is the owner of a chain of restaurants"
  ticket holder holder of a ticket (for admission or for passage)
  bondholder a holder of bonds issued by a government or corporation
  cardholder a player who holds a card or cards in a card game

  incumbent, officeholder the official who holds an office
  jobholder an employee who holds a regular job
  landholder, landowner, property owner a holder or proprietor of land
  leaseholder, lessee a tenant who holds a lease
  mortgage holder, mortgagee the person who accepts a mortgage; "the bank became our mortgagee when it accepted our mortgage on our new home"
  officeholder, officer someone who is appointed or elected to an office and who holds a position of trust; "he is an officer of the court"; "the club elected its officers for the coming year"
  policyholder a person who holds an insurance policy; usually, the client in whose name an insurance policy is written
  slave owner, slaveholder, slaver someone who holds slaves
holder - a holding device; "a towel holder"; "a cigarette holder"; "an umbrella holder"
  holding device a device for holding something
  candle holder, candlestick a holder with sockets for candles
  cigarette holder a tube that holds a cigarette while it is being smoked
  keyboard holder consisting of an arrangement of hooks on which keys or locks can be hung
  oarlock, rowlock, thole, tholepin, peg, pin a wooden pin pushed or driven into a surface
holder - the person who is in possession of a check or note or bond or document of title that is endorsed to him or to whoever holds it; "the bond was marked `payable to bearer'"
  bearer
  capitalist a person who invests capital in a business (especially a large business)

  • holder (Noun)
    A thing that holds.
  • holder (Noun)
    A person who temporarily or permanently possesses something.
  • holder (Noun)
    One who is employed in the hold of a vessel.

Webster DictionaryWebster's Unabridged Dictionary 📘

  • holder (n.)
    One who is employed in the hold of a vessel.
  • holder (n.)
    One who, or that which, holds.
  • holder (n.)
    One who holds land, etc., under another; a tenant.
  • holder (n.)
    The payee of a bill of exchange or a promissory note, or the one who owns or holds it.

OmegaWiki DictionaryOmegaWiki Dictionary Ω

  • holder
    A person who temporarily or permanently possesses something.
